WebEven taking small amounts of meth can cause harmful health effects, including: Increased blood pressure and body temperature Faster breathing Rapid or irregular heartbeat Loss … WebSep 17, 2024 · Crystal meth goes by many different names. You might hear it called ice, crystal, tina, speed (traditionally a name for amphetamine), crank, jib, shards, or gak. 2 It can look like slightly transparent crystals or bluish-white rocks. Meth can be taken in many different ways. Most commonly, it is snorted, smoked in a pipe, or injected, but ...
